Download fileDirections for model building from asymptotic safety

posted on 2023-06-09, 09:26 authored by Andrew D Bond, Gudrun Hiller, Kamila Kowalska, Daniel LitimDaniel LitimBuilding on recent advances in the understanding of gauge-Yukawa theories we explore possibilities to UV-complete the Standard Model in an asymptotically safe manner. Minimal extensions are based on a large avor sector of additional fermions coupled to a scalar singlet matrix field. We find that asymptotic safety requires fermions in higher representations of SU(3)C SU(2)L. Possible signatures at colliders are worked out and include R-hadron searches, diboson signatures and the evolution of the strong and weak coupling constants.
